Product Description - General 

Waters’ ES family of enclosed switches provides the switching speed and reliability to smoothly 

support multiple workgroups at 10Mbps or 100Mbps speed. The optional fiber port is configured and 
tested in the factory and is available in all popular fiber connectors. 

The ES-FUTP “Future-proof Fiber” models have been designed with one full-duplex 100Mbps 

switched fiber port, and seven “N-way” switched RJ45 with full/half-duplex 10/100 auto-negotiating RJ45 
ports. The ES-CUTP “Copper” model has been designed with all eight RJ45 switched ports with “N-way” 
x half/full duplex capability and functions as 10/100 auto-negotiating ports. 

Designed for use in labs, classrooms and in network traffic centers, the ES switches are easy to 

install and use.  Addresses of attached nodes are automatically learned and maintained, adapting the 
switching services to network changes and expansions. Top-mounted LEDs provide status information 
on each port. The ES switches provide high performance plug-and-play operation in compact packages. 

The ES switches are non-blocking on all ports and include 1MB packet buffers and 16K-node 

address table for advanced performance.  With store-and-forward switching, the switches filter all faulty 
packets to minimize traffic congestion. 

 

2.2.1 ES-FUTP 

Switch 

The ES-FUTP-8 chassis houses one main PC board.  The power supply unit is external.  The 

front side of the chassis has eight RJ45 twisted-pair ports and one 100Mbps fiber port.  Port # 2SW 
supports the fiber port only and the RJ45 connector is inoperative at all times.  LEDs to indicate 
operating status of all ports are mounted on the top.  There are power (PWR) and ERROR (self-test at 
power up failed) indicators for the unit. For each port, there are Link and Activity (LINK/ACT) LEDs 
indicating traffic, and speed (ON for 100Mbps), and full/half (F/H) duplex indicators. 
 

The DC power plug connector or “jack” is in the left rear of the chassis. The external power 

supply is 5VDC at 95 - 125vac at 60 Hz. 

 
2.2.2  ES-CUTP-8 with all RJ45 copper ports 

The ES-CUTP-8 houses one main PC board and the power supply unit is external.  The front 

side of the switch has eight twisted-pair switched ports.  Port 2SW has manually selectable full-fixed and 
auto-negotiation capability.  See section 4.4. 

LEDs to indicate operating status of all ports are mounted on the top.  There are power (PWR) 

and ERROR (self-test at power up failed) indicators for the unit. For each port, there are Link and 
Activity (LINK/ACT) LEDs indicating traffic, speed (ON for 100Mbps), and full/half duplex (F/H is ON for 
full duplex) indicators. 

The DC power plug connector or “jack” is in the left rear of the chassis, like the ES-FUTP-8. The 

external 5VDC power supply is for 95 - 125vac at 60 Hz. 

 

2.3 

Uplink Port 1SW for Cascading

 

The unit has an uplink Port #1 or 1SW, located on the left-front side of the switch.  It enables the 

port’s twisted pair cable to cascade to another shared hub or switch.  (See Section 4.6 for more details 
about uplink).  Port #1SW is capable of full- and half-duplex mode auto-sensing, based on the capability 
of the connected device.  The uplink feature operates the same, whether Port # 1SW is connected to 
either 100Mbps or 10Mbps devices. When the uplink port is used to cascade two ES switches, the auto-
sensing feature will cause the connecting link to operate at 100Mbps speed and full-duplex mode.
